Thigh Lift
A thigh lift is performed to elevate the lateral or side of the thigh to streamline
the profile of the leg. It can be combined with a tummy tuck and/or a buttock
lift. A more extensive procedure called a torsoplasty also includes a thigh

During this procedure, an incision is placed on the hip in the bikini line,
and the length depends on the amount of lift needed. Liposuction of the lateral
thigh is performed to straighten the leg.
A thigh lift can usually be done in our outpatient surgery center. General
anesthesia is used and administrated by our licensed M.D. or CRNA, in our
fully accredited operating suite. It can be done as an outpatient procedure,
and you go home with a family or friend who can help you recover for the next
24 hours. Patients wear a support garment for at least 2 weeks after surgery
and usually return to work and normal activity in 10 days to 2 weeks. Optimal
results help you achieve a slimmer profile in a swimsuit or shorts.
